3-phase 27.6kW inverter (max 37.250kWp DC module power) for use with SolarEdge Power Optimizers
Your SolarEdge PV System
SolarEdge optimizes the entire PV power harvesting process. By optimizing performance at the module level, each individual module in the SolarEdge system always delivers its maximum yield (MPP). Maintaining a constant string voltage allows for more flexible system design and unlimited use of the entire roof area. Module-level PV monitoring provides accurate remote diagnostics for accurate fault detection.
The result: an increased yield of clean energy at a low price per watt and maximum returns for system owners and operators.
SolarEdge Advantages:
Maximum energy yield (up to 25% more power)- More powerful Maximum Power Point Tracking (MPPT)
- No loss of yield due to partial shading or partially suboptimal alignment of the modules
- No loss of yield due to performance deviation between modules (mismatch)
- No loss of yield due to undervoltage or overvoltage
Flexible system design, simple and fast installation
- Unlike traditional solar installations, the SolarEdge system allows complete design flexibility
- Uncomplicated system design through the connection of strings of unequal
Length to a central PV inverter
- Even systems on angled roofs with several levels can be designed with a single-string inverter
- Between 15% and 25% less time and cost for installation
Real-time monitoring and fault diagnosis at module level
- Real-time monitoring enables efficient fault diagnosis and maintenance of the solar PV system
- The module-based monitoring system continuously determines data on module performance
- Automatic error message thanks to data analysis software
- Communication of the data to the Monitoring Portal takes place via existing DC lines, therefore no additional cables are necessary
- The data logger is also already present in the solar inverter
Increased safety for plumbers and firefighters
- Highest possible safety due to switch-off function of the modules.
- Voltage release (1 Volt per module) is effected as soon as the system is disconnected on either the AC or DC side.
- Best possible protection during installation and maintenance work. Disconnection prevents the risk of electric shock and allows the correct installation to be checked
- Best possible fire protection due to release during fire fighting
